My male surgical onc in Fla insisted that lumpectomy was as good as mastectomy. When I went to a female surg onc, she insisted I have a mastectomy. The Plastic surgeon insisted on mastectomy. Because I had multifocal disease, I sought 3 opinions and the final opinion from a UPenn tumor board was: 3 were for lumpectomy and 2 were for mastectomy. All the male docs suggested the lumpectomy and the female docs suggested mastectomy... like that should make a difference. In the end I opted for lumpectomy.

I know you are looking for reconstruction, but I think that doc's decisions stem from their personal familiarity, knowledge and experience.
I really believe that all doc's have their reasons for whatever surgical (or not) procedure they deem appropriate. In the end, the decision is really up to you. If you feel you have the cancer under control- or eliminated all together... go for it!
